Guwahati, 16 May (HS): Security agencies guarding Assam’s international border have once again foiled an infiltration attempt, with 14 alleged illegal entrants being stopped before entering Indian territory, Chief Minister Dr Himanta Biswa Sarma informed on Saturday.

Sharing the information through a post on social media platform, the Chief Minister credited the joint vigilance of the Assam Police and the Border Security Force for successfully identifying and intercepting the group near the border.

Sarma said security personnel deployed along the frontier remain on constant alert to prevent illegal infiltration attempts. “Our forces are highly alert on the border and thwarting infiltration attempts,” he stated while praising the role of the jawans involved in the operation.

Reaffirming the government’s stand against illegal entry, the Chief Minister asserted that strict monitoring and action against infiltrators would continue under the campaign “#AssamAgainstInfiltrators”.

Notably, this is the second such operation reported within two days. On May 14, the Chief Minister had announced that 12 alleged infiltrators were similarly intercepted by the Assam Police and BSF before they could enter Assam.------------
